Why Chicken & Waffles Remains a Brunch Favorite

Chicken & waffles just keeps chugging along as a brunch fave. Even chain restaurants have gotten into the game, making it more mainstream and giving chefs a chance to put their own spins on the classic. The riff at Napa Restaurant Group, which runs four locations in North and South Carolina, features a dusting of Ethiopian berbere spice.

Step-by-Step Chicken & Waffles Recipe

Step 1 – Brine the chicken in buttermilk

The brine also contains a little hot sauce, crushed garlicpeppercorns and thyme for a 48-hour marinade.

Step 2 – Mix the Batter for Extra Crunch

The addition of cornstarchbaking powder and baking soda helps activate the acid in the buttermilk to create more crunch.


Step 3 – Double-Fry for Maximum Crispiness

Blanch the chicken in oil at 325°F; then do a second fry at 350°F until browned and crisp.

Step 4 – Make the Waffles and Seasonings.

These waffles get a dusting of salted berbere spice and a drizzle of hot honey made with garlic, coriander, thyme, bay leaves and Aleppo pepper.
